One of the weirdest things to me about the tech scene for AI is you regularly hear variants on "Super-human intelligence is coming next year and will permanently alter life as we know it. Prepare your business and finances accordingly." Setting aside what you think about the first half, how does the second half make any sense? Like... what would you do differently, other than move to the woods?
The second half is what tells you they don't actually believe the first.
It's like a Christian proclaiming the immanent Rapture and investing in their 401k - their actions put the lie to their words.
